Fractal Possession is an album by Abigor, released in 2007. A relentless exploration of darkness, weaving intricate melodies with dissonant soundscapes and harsh vocals. 'Fractal Possession' marked a significant evolution in Abigor’s discography, gaining critical acclaim for its ambitious sound. The album is noted for its influence on the avant-garde metal scene, showcasing complex compositions that pushed the boundaries of traditional black metal. Released in 2007, 'Fractal Possession' is Abigor's fifth studio album, following their 2005 release 'Fractured Spectrum'. At this point in their career, the band was solidifying their avant-garde approach within the black metal genre, evolving their sound into more experimental territory.
